Max Fried starts as Braves begin series against Padres

May 17, 2024 by Talking Chop

Miami Marlins v Atlanta Braves
Photo by Kevin D. Liles/Atlanta Braves/Getty Images

Max Fried looks to continue his recent dominance Friday when the Braves begin a four-game series against the Padres

The Atlanta Braves will begin a four-game home series Friday night against the San Diego Padres. The Braves are coming off of a series win against the Chicago Cubs as Atlanta to start their homestand. Max Fried will get the start Friday night for Atlanta while the Padres will go with right-hander Matt Waldron.

Fried will make his ninth start of the season in Friday’s game and will be looking to continue his recent run of success. Fried dominated the New York Mets in his last start as he turned in seven no-hit innings to go along with five strikeouts. Fried’s has a 1.79 ERA and a 3.66 FIP over his last six starts combined. A big reason for Fried’s recent success on the mound has been his ability to get ground-ball outs. Fried currently holds a 62.9% ground-ball rate which is his highest rate since the 2017 season. Fried has had success in his career against the Padres posting a 1.67 ERA is currently 3-0 against the Padres in his career with an impressive 1.67 ERA and a 2.81 FIP in four career starts against San Diego.

Waldron is coming off a solid outing where he allowed two runs over 5 1⁄3 innings against the Dodgers. He has had an up and down season to date and will be making his first career appearance against Atlanta. Waldron won’t overpower anyone and throws a variety of pitches including an effective knuckleball.

The Braves are expected to get reliever Pierce Johnson back from the injured list on Friday. Johnson has been on the IL while dealing with inflammation in his elbow. Austin Riley missed the last three games with soreness in his side. He could return as soon as Friday’s series opener. Ronald Acuña Jr. got the day off on Wednesday, but is healthy and will be back in the lineup for the series opener.

First pitch Friday is scheduled for 7:20 p.m. ET and can be seen on Bally Sports South.
